PAUL, GEORGE ROBERT, second son of Sir John Dean Paul, Bart. (adm. 1787, qv); b. 27 Jul 1803; adm. 22 Jan 1817 (Packharness'); Min. Can. 1818; left 11 May 1819; at Haileybury Coll. 1821-2; Writer, EICS Bengal 1823; arrived in India 29 Oct 1823; Assistant to Magistrate, Ghazipur 26 Aug 1824, to Magistrate and Collector 3 Mar 1825; res. 1832; m. 15 Mar 1828 Louisa Harriet, youngest dau. of Henry Bevan, London; d. 14 Apr 1880.

Paul, George Constantine, son of Paul Paul, R.B.A., of Chiswick, by Marion, daughter of W. Archer, of Kettering, Northants; b. Dec. 6, 1896; adm. Sept. 22, 1910 (A); left July 1914; en­listed in the wth Batt. (T.F.) Liverpool Regt. June 1915; killed in action at Ypres, Flanders, Oct. 17, 1915.

PAUL, CHRISTOPHER, son of Right Rev. William Paul DD, Bishop of Oxford, and his third wife Rachel, dau. of Sir Christopher Clitherow MP, Alderman and Lord Mayor of London, and his second wife; b.; at school 1660-1 (Busby’s Account Book); Trinity Coll. Oxford, matr. 22 Jun 1662, aged 16; BA 1665; adm. Inner Temple, called to bar 28 Nov 1669; buried Brightwell Baldwin, Oxfordshire 18 Aug 1671.

PAUL, ALEXANDER STUART SILVER, eldest son of Deputy Inspector-Gen. John Leston Paul, MD, EICS Madras, and Annie Amelia, eldest dau. of James Shaw, EICS Madras, Inspector-Gen. of Hospitals, Madras; b. 7 Jun 1866; adm. 24 Jan 1878 (H); left Dec 1881; d. 5 Dec 1902.

Pauer, William Michael, son of John Pauer, Prof. of Pianoforte RCM, and Viola Rachel, d. of William Cumin Scott of Blackheath; b. 6 Mar. 1922; adm. Sept. 1935 (A); left July 1940; RNVR 1942-5 (Lieut.); BA (Lond.) 1954; a schoolmaster, retd 1981; m. 13 Aug. 1949 Florence Dorothy, d. of Col. George Orlebar Boase CBE RA, of Bexhill, Sussex; d. 2008.

PATTON, THOMAS; b.; adm. (aged 13) Jan 1745/6 (Preston's); left 1748 (as Patten in school lists 1747, 1748). [Note Thomas Patten, son of Thomas Patten, Warrington, Lancs., and Lettice, second dau. of Rev. James Peake, Bowden, Cheshire; bapt. Warrington 29 Apr 1731 (IGI); Corpus Christi Coll. Oxford, matr. 14 Jan 1748/9, aged 16; MA 27 Feb 1752; of Bank Hall, Warrington, Lancs.; High Sheriff Lancashire 1773, Cheshire 1775; DL JP Lancashire; Lieut. -Col., Royal Lancashire Militia; m. 17 Jan 1757 Dorothea, dau. of Peter Bold MP, Bold, Lancs.; d. 19 Mar 1806]

PATTON, THOMAS; son of Paul Patton, Flintshire; brother of Paul Patton (qv); b.; adm. (aged 12) Sep 1740; left 1744; merchant for British Factory in Leghorn (Livorno); m. Margaret, dau. of Sir James Douglas, British Consul in Naples; d. 1796. [Name formalised later as PANTON, THOMAS].

PATTON, ROBERT, brother of David Patton (qv); b.; adm. (aged 7) Jun 1732; d. 12 Sep 1733. Buried West Cloister, Westminster Abbey.
